Job Responsibilities:
- Perform in-depth analysis and debugging of failing units from various stages of the manufacturing process, including in-circuit test (ICT), functional test (FCT), and system-level test (SLT).
- Utilize a range of diagnostic tools, including oscilloscopes, multimeters, spectrum analyzers, and logic analyzers, to pinpoint root causes of failures.
- Collaborate with design engineering, manufacturing, and quality teams to implement effective corrective and preventive actions.
- Develop and implement test procedures and fixtures to improve test coverage and efficiency.
- Document test results, failure modes, and debugging steps accurately and comprehensively.
- Provide technical support and training to production operators on test processes and troubleshooting techniques.
- Participate in continuous improvement initiatives to enhance product reliability and manufacturing yield.
- Work independently and as part of a team in a fast-paced manufacturing environment during night shift hours.
- Adhere to all safety regulations and quality standards.
